#footer{ margin-top: 30px; border-top:#5db23d 2px solid;}
#footer div.w1200{background:url(/images/footerBg.png) no-repeat left bottom;}
#footer dl{padding:0 0 10px 60px; float:left; width:238px; min-height:115px; overflow:hidden; border-left:#E9E9E9 1px solid; border-right:#FFFFFF 1px solid;}
#footer dl.first{border-left:none;}
#footer dl.last{border-right:none;}
#footer dl dt{font-family:'微软雅黑',Arial, Helvetica, sans-serif; font-size:18px; margin-bottom:20px;}
#footer dl dd{ width:118px; float:left; margin-bottom:15px;}
#footer dl.app_foot dd{float:none;font-family:'微软雅黑',Arial, Helvetica, sans-serif;}
#footer dl.app_foot dd a{ display:block; width:130px; height:42px; line-height:42px; border:#E9E9E9 1px solid; border-radius:3px; text-align:center; color:#2880be;}
#footer dl.app_foot dd a i{font-size:20px; color:#A7A8A8;}
#footer dl.app_foot dd a.android_foot,#footer dl.app_foot dd a.android_foot i{color:#5DB23D;}
#footer dl.app_foot dd a:hover{text-decoration:none; background-color:#FFF;}

#footer dl.last dd{float:none; position:relative; padding:5px 0 0 60px;}
#footer dl.last dd img{ border:#E9E9E9 3px solid;}
#footer dl.last dd a{display:block;}
#footer dl.last dd a.but{border:#E9E9E9 1px solid; width:70px; height:18px; line-height:18px; overflow:hidden; text-align:center; margin-top:5px;}
#footer dl.last dd a.but:hover{background-color:#FFF; text-decoration:none;}
/*footer end*/

/* 焦点图旁的文章列表 */
#focus_news.list{
    margin: 0 20px;
    height: 328px;
}

/* 最新资讯 */
#new_info .list:first-child{
    margin-top: 0;
}

/* 康复病例 */
#recover_case{
}

#recover_case .panel_body .list:first-child {
    margin-top: -3px;
}

/* (疾病名)课堂 */
#illness_course .illness_list{
    min-height: 232px;
}

#illness_course .list_default{
    border-top: 1px dashed #d5d5d5;
    margin: 3px 0 0 0;
    padding-top: 5px;
}

/* 推荐阅读 */
#recommend_read{
}

#recommend_read .panel_body{
    padding-top: 3px;
}

#recommend_read .list_item{
    padding: 0 0 10px 14px;
    margin-top: 12px;
    background: url("../images/list_default_liststyle.png") no-repeat 0 9px;
    border-bottom: 1px dashed #d5d5d5;
}

#recommend_read .list_item:last-child{
    border-bottom: none;
}

#recommend_read .list_item_para {
    margin-top: 0;
}
